Matter
Anything that occupies space and has mass, composed of atoms or molecules and is the substance that makes up the physical universe.
States
Different forms in which matter can exist, typically observed as solid, liquid, gas, and plasma.
Solid
A state of matter characterized by particles that are closely packed together, resulting in a fixed volume and shape.
Liquid
A state of matter characterized by a definite volume but no fixed shape, conforming to the shape of its container.
